NTE's THERMO-PADS do away with the old
fashioned mica wafer and conductive grease
method of mounting power semiconductors.
These thermally conductive insulators offer
low heat transfer resistance while still provid‐
ing high electrical isolation between the parts
of the assembly. The elastomeric material
combines the electrical isolation of rigid insu‐
lators with the ability to conform to rough sur‐
faces and reduce contact resistance in much
the same manner as thermal greases. Proper
selection and use of these THERMO-PADS
results in a securely-mounted power semi‐
conductor and minimum resistance to the
heat transfer between it and the heat sink.
